Would the back side of the headlight bucket be painted body color, red oxide with over spray, or bare pot metal with over spray? Probably should have thought of this sooner but just thinking of it know as I go to install the buckets. :-[
-
They should have some over spray on them. Marty
-
Thanks Marty. No primer then, just bare pot metal with over spray. I guess I need to recreate the bare pot metal look.
-
Steve,
The line worker was only interested in painting the outside, he did not car about the back so you expect to see paint over spray with some primer in the tight areas.
-
Thanks Marty. No primer then, just bare pot metal with over spray. I guess I need to recreate the bare pot metal look.
Allot of the ones I see have allot of nice exterior color on them (consider the direction of paint application of the exterior surfaces and you will understand why) but allot less in the nooks and crannies on the back side.
A base of falr gray (play with some rattle cans) should fill your need to reproduce the original pot metal - remember to use only light coats so as not to look painted ;)
